Program Educational Objectives

Alumni of our program should have the following accomplishments:

  1. Have the technical expertise necessary for the broad practice of Industrial and Systems Engineering. This includes analytical, computational and experimental expertise and the ability to integrate and synthesize their expertise to solve complex problems.
  2. View technical problems from a systems perspective with attention to human, business, equipment, materials, energy and information aspects and with appreciation of global and societal contexts.
  3. Be effective communicators of technical ideas through oral and written media and be effective members and/or leaders of diverse teams.
  4. Practice life-long learning in a changing world and its effect on the practice of industrial engineering with concern for ethics, currency of expertise and contemporary issues.
